2.\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0 Student Center<\/h3>\n

This project began 3 or 4 years ago but with the overall climate and construction costs rising, the project was reviewed to determine the overall budget based on today\u2019s market. The decision, after evaluating the outcome, was to prepare the bid package with various cost alternates in order to control the final project cost. The alternates can be added back in if it is determined there will be left over funds.\u00a0 The bid package should go out in January and be open for bids in February.<\/p>\n

    3.\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0 Land Acquisition Plan<\/h3>\n

    Brock McMurray, Executive Vice President, Administrative Services, reminded the committee the Educational Master Plan (EMP) is the guide for Taft College to help meet the educational needs of our students. Born from the EMP was the Strategic Master Plan (SMP) which identified the need for a Facilities Master Plan (FMP). One of the components of the FMP is the Land Acquisition Plan due to the college being land\u2010locked and the need for more space. Brock has been working with Kevin Cobb, AP Architects, to identify how much space and type of space we are in the market for and what the cost will be.\u00a0 There will be more to come on this topic.<\/p>\n
